Coming back to and re-reading Wilkie Collin’s The Moonstone is like coming back to an old friend. I was introduced to this author and novel years ago, and I have been pretty hooked on reading Collins ever since. Although Collins has many other brilliant longer novels (No Name, Armadale, The Woman in White), The Moonstone is probably the best known of the bunch. At the root of The Moonstone is a mysterious and highly sought after diamond.
